We are PXC, the UKs largest provider of wholesale connectivity. Our vision is to be the UKs #1 wholesale platform, a one-stop shop provider of connectivity, voice, cloud and security underpinned by the UKs most robust, secure, resilient and reliable network. Born from the combination of Virtual1 and TalkTalks wholesale services and national network business, we operate across our 3 core sites (Salford, London and Skopje, North Macedonia). About the Role To be successful in achieving our vision, its imperative that we develop and establish strong relationships with new and current suppliers. The Contract Manager will lead on in-life management of our key Technology Outsourcing Suppliers as well as supporting sourcing activity. You will support the negotiation & operationalising of commercial agreements, and responsible for overall contract management. You will interface with all stakeholders in your strategic, business function to understand requirements and pain points with existing vendors and will work with the Technology, Change & Operations function to establish key areas of focus aligned to the PXC Strategic Roadmap and drive meaningful change in the contractual arrangements with key suppliers. Key Responsibilities

  • Outsource Partner lead be the category and contract lead both internally with stakeholders and externally with vendors. Lead, maintain and develop contractual relationships with all suppliers.
  • Contract Management Daily management of contractual obligations, including risk management, compliance & analysis. Responsible for contractual improvements and simplification, ensuring we have processes in place to manage the commitments within the contracts.
  • Contract Analysis – Ability to review and simplify complex information and concepts and communicate internally (contractual and regulatory documentation).
  • Stakeholder engagement build positive and collaborative relationships with your stakeholder community to identify opportunities and requirements early. Socialising the mechanics and principles of the contracts across all the organization teams, driving contractual adoption and adherence.
  • Financial Analysis conduct a full and detailed third party spend analysis and budget review alongside the the relevant category finance business partner. Collaborate with the finance, accounting and data teams to take a data-led approach to articulate problem statements and interpret financial statements, and commercial KPIs.
  • Negotiation E2E ownership of any contractual changes required for in-life commercial changes. Support the management and negotiations of commercial terms (both the initial set-up and the ongoing monitoring, benchmarking, and evaluation of commercial offers).
  • Communication – Provide weekly updates on contractual commits, risks, issues and escalations and provide thought leadership on key commercial initiatives.
  • Deliver results support and deliver the best commercial outcomes and contribute to PXC savings targets as well as negotiating the best contract terms possible
  • Behaviours delivers results in the right way via PXCs core values
